          Jürgen Hubert Have you had the chance to play Dawnbury Days? It’s a short, independent, grid-based video game based on the PF2e rule set, and it’s a pretty good experience.

          It’s not quite how I run the game – I like to massage and bend it to my purposes – but it gives you a default, RAW adventure where you can kick the tires for just a few euro.
